Wilbraham zip code serves as the primary postal identifier for residents and businesses in this town located in Hampden County, Massachusetts. Understanding how this code functions helps improve mail delivery, location services, and local commerce.
Using the correct Wilbraham zip code reduces delivery errors, speeds up online purchases, and supports accurate geolocation for services ranging from emergency response to retail analytics. This guide outlines key details you need to know.
| Postal Code | Town | County | State | Time Zone |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 01095 | Wilbraham | Hampden County | Massachusetts | Eastern |
Wilbraham Zip Code Boundaries And Delivery Areas
Primary Zone 01095
The Wilbraham zip code 01095 covers the majority of the town, including the main village centers and surrounding residential neighborhoods. Postal routes branch out from the central distribution point to ensure consistent delivery.
